Some things that has helped me are to record lectures (ask your instructors first to make sure they are ok with it), take copious notes (not just during lecture ), and type your notes to include notes from lectures, reading, etc. Having to retype everything helps get things in there a second time and gives you an electronic copy should your paper copies get damaged or lost. After typing notes up, make flashcards for key concepts and terms. I usually would put them in card organizers or on a binder ring for quick moments (breaks, lunches, etc) to read. I also use color coding to organize different subjects etc. Form study groups to quiz each other, review materials, etc. Practice and review as much as possible, but remember to recharge yourself. Exercise, enough sleep, proper nutrition and hydration, and just plain laughter helps immensely!
